About Andrea D’Ariano

Andrea D’Ariano is a scholar working on Industrial and Manufacturing Engineering, Transportation and General Economics, Econometrics and Finance, having authored 189 papers that have together received 5.7k indexed citations. Recurring topics across this work include Railway Systems and Energy Efficiency (125 papers), Transportation Planning and Optimization (101 papers) and Railway Engineering and Dynamics (72 papers). The work is most often cited by research in Transportation (3.4k citations), Industrial and Manufacturing Engineering (4.5k citations) and Mechanical Engineering (2.6k citations). Andrea D’Ariano has collaborated with scholars based in Italy, China and Netherlands. Frequent co-authors include Dario Pacciarelli, Marco Pranzo, Francesco Corman, Marcella Samà, Ingo A. Hansen, Jiateng Yin, Lixing Yang, Tao Tang, Lingyun Meng and Yihui Wang. Their work appears in journals such as SHILAP Revista de lepidopterología, Journal of Cleaner Production and European Journal of Operational Research.
